* DoingItForTheArt: Most of this game's energy is put into showing off what the Super Nintendo can do, pushing its limits.
* StillbornFranchise: Beating the game on its hardest difficulty level on the second loop gives a message at the end of the credits, saying "SEE YOU AGAIN AT [=AXELAY2=]". Unfortunately, no sequel was made.
